3 Mobile to Offer Spotify Music Soon

November 12th, 2009

The UK’s top mobile operator 3 has signed up with Spotify to make the latter’s huge library of music available to its future customers. The deal, which was worked out recently, will be a second such deal of bringing music to the mobile handset. 3 was also the first mobile operator to sign up Nokia’s revolutionary ‘Comes with Music’ deal.

The music service will be launched with the introduction of the HTC Hero mobile handset, which 3 is expected to unveil during Christmas this year. Later on, more models will have Spotify music as part of their basic package. While tariffs have not been decided yet, Spotify might prefer to offer its premium (advert-free) services on mobile handsets.

Spotify has confirmed that this deal is aimed at broadening its user base. By making it a mobile phone compatible feature, Spotify will expand its services reach millions of mobile phones users. The current Spotify application offers legal access to a huge library of music for invitees only.

Internet geeks as well as other users have shown immense interest in this application. The company expects that with such proven demand, its plan to turn mobile phones into access tools will surely find success.
